Clearly Define the Role and Responsibilities

  • Key Responsibilities: A Drone Design employee is responsible for conceptualizing, designing, prototyping, and refining unmanned aerial vehicles (UAVs) to meet specific business objectives. In medium to large organizations, their duties often include collaborating with engineering, software, and operations teams to define requirements; selecting appropriate materials and components; creating detailed CAD models; performing simulations and physical testing; ensuring compliance with aviation regulations; and overseeing the integration of sensors, cameras, and communication systems. They may also be involved in troubleshooting, documenting design processes, and supporting manufacturing or field deployment.
  • Experience Levels: Junior Drone Design employees typically have 0-2 years of experience and may focus on supporting tasks such as CAD modeling, basic prototyping, and documentation. Mid-level professionals, with 3-6 years of experience, often take ownership of subsystems, lead small projects, and contribute to design reviews. Senior Drone Design employees, with 7+ years of experience, are expected to drive overall system architecture, mentor junior staff, engage with external stakeholders, and ensure that designs align with strategic business goals. Senior roles may also require experience with regulatory compliance and large-scale deployment.
  • Company Fit: In medium-sized companies (50-500 employees), Drone Design employees may wear multiple hats, handling both design and implementation, and collaborating closely with cross-functional teams. Flexibility and a broad skill set are valuable. In large organizations (500+ employees), roles tend to be more specialized, with clear delineation between design, testing, and manufacturing. Large companies may also require experience with enterprise-level project management, regulatory documentation, and integration with other business systems.

Certifications

Certifications play a significant role in validating a Drone Design employee's expertise and commitment to industry standards. While not always mandatory, they can set candidates apart and provide assurance to employers regarding technical proficiency and regulatory knowledge.

Unmanned Aircraft Systems (UAS) Certification: Offered by organizations such as the Association for Unmanned Vehicle Systems International (AUVSI) and the Federal Aviation Administration (FAA), UAS certifications cover the fundamentals of drone technology, safety protocols, and regulatory compliance. For example, the FAA's Part 107 Remote Pilot Certificate is essential for professionals involved in commercial drone operations, ensuring they understand airspace rules, flight restrictions, and operational safety.

Certified UAV Design Engineer (CUDE): This certification, provided by specialized training institutes, focuses on the technical aspects of drone design, including aerodynamics, propulsion systems, avionics, and payload integration. Candidates typically need a background in engineering and must pass both written and practical exams. The CUDE credential demonstrates a deep understanding of the end-to-end design process and is highly valued in organizations developing custom UAV solutions.

SolidWorks Certified Professional (CSWP) or Autodesk Certified Professional: Proficiency in CAD software is critical for Drone Design employees. Certifications from software vendors such as Dassault Systèmes (SolidWorks) or Autodesk validate a candidate's ability to create complex models, assemblies, and simulations. These certifications require passing rigorous exams and are recognized globally.

Project Management Certifications: For senior roles, certifications like Project Management Professional (PMP) or Agile Certified Practitioner (PMI-ACP) can be beneficial. These credentials demonstrate the ability to manage complex design projects, coordinate cross-functional teams, and deliver results on time and within budget.

Value to Employers: Certified professionals bring a standardized level of knowledge and skill, reducing onboarding time and increasing confidence in their ability to navigate regulatory environments. Certifications also indicate a commitment to ongoing professional development and adherence to industry best practices. For organizations operating in highly regulated industries or seeking to innovate at scale, hiring certified Drone Design employees can mitigate risk and accelerate project timelines.

Assess Technical Skills

  • Tools and Software: Drone Design employees must be proficient in a range of specialized tools and technologies. Key software includes CAD platforms such as SolidWorks, Autodesk Inventor, and CATIA for 3D modeling and simulation. Familiarity with finite element analysis (FEA) tools like ANSYS or COMSOL is essential for structural and thermal analysis. Knowledge of embedded systems programming (C/C++, Python) is valuable for integrating flight controllers and sensors. Experience with PCB design tools (Altium Designer, Eagle) is important for custom electronics. Additionally, understanding of communication protocols (e.g., MAVLink, CAN bus) and hands-on experience with rapid prototyping tools (3D printers, CNC machines) are highly desirable.
  • Assessments: Evaluating technical proficiency requires a multi-faceted approach. Practical assessments, such as design challenges or take-home projects, allow candidates to demonstrate their ability to create drone components or solve real-world engineering problems. Technical interviews should include questions on aerodynamics, propulsion, and regulatory considerations. Software proficiency can be assessed through live CAD modeling exercises or coding tests. Reviewing a candidate's portfolio of previous drone projects, including design documentation and test results, provides insight into their hands-on experience and problem-solving abilities. Reference checks with former supervisors or project leads can further validate technical skills and project contributions.

Evaluate Soft Skills and Cultural Fit

  • Communication: Effective Drone Design employees must excel at communicating complex technical concepts to both technical and non-technical stakeholders. They often work with cross-functional teams, including software developers, project managers, regulatory experts, and end-users. The ability to articulate design decisions, present findings, and document processes is essential for ensuring alignment and facilitating smooth project execution. During interviews, look for candidates who can clearly explain their design rationale and respond thoughtfully to feedback.
  • Problem-Solving: Drone design is a field that frequently encounters novel challenges, from integrating new sensors to meeting evolving regulatory requirements. Successful candidates demonstrate a proactive approach to problem-solving, using analytical thinking, creativity, and resourcefulness. During interviews, present hypothetical scenarios or past project challenges and ask candidates to walk through their problem-solving process. Look for evidence of structured thinking, adaptability, and a willingness to seek input from others.
  • Attention to Detail: Precision is critical in drone design, where small errors can lead to significant performance or safety issues. Assess attention to detail by reviewing a candidate's design documentation, code samples, or test reports. Ask about quality assurance practices, such as peer reviews or simulation validation. Candidates who consistently produce thorough, error-free work are more likely to contribute to reliable and successful drone projects.

Conduct Thorough Background and Reference Checks

Conducting a thorough background check is a vital step in the hiring process for Drone Design employees. Start by verifying the candidate's employment history, focusing on roles that involved UAV design, engineering, or related technical responsibilities. Request detailed references from previous supervisors, project managers, or academic advisors who can speak to the candidate's technical abilities, work ethic, and collaboration skills.

Confirm all claimed certifications by contacting the issuing organizations directly or using online verification tools. For roles requiring regulatory knowledge, such as FAA Part 107 certification, ensure that credentials are current and valid. Review academic transcripts or degree certificates for positions that require specific educational backgrounds, such as aerospace or mechanical engineering.

In addition to technical verification, assess the candidate's reputation within the industry. Search for published papers, patents, or contributions to open-source projects that demonstrate expertise and thought leadership. For senior roles, consider conducting a background check for any history of regulatory violations or safety incidents related to drone operations.

Finally, conduct a standard criminal background check in accordance with local laws and company policy. For positions involving sensitive data or proprietary technology, additional screening may be warranted. A comprehensive background check not only mitigates risk but also ensures that you are hiring a Drone Design employee who meets your organization's standards for integrity and professionalism.

Offer Competitive Compensation and Benefits

  • Market Rates: Compensation for Drone Design employees varies based on experience, location, and industry. As of 2024, junior Drone Design professionals typically earn between $65,000 and $85,000 annually in major metropolitan areas. Mid-level employees with 3-6 years of experience can expect salaries ranging from $85,000 to $115,000. Senior Drone Design employees, especially those with specialized expertise or leadership responsibilities, may command salaries from $120,000 to $160,000 or more. In regions with a high concentration of aerospace or technology companies, such as California, Texas, or the Pacific Northwest, salaries may be 10-20% higher than the national average. Remote work opportunities and contract roles can also influence compensation structures.
  • Benefits: To attract and retain top Drone Design talent, offer a comprehensive benefits package that goes beyond salary. Standard benefits include health, dental, and vision insurance, retirement plans with employer matching, and paid time off. Additional perks that appeal to Drone Design professionals include professional development budgets for attending conferences or obtaining certifications, flexible work schedules, and opportunities for remote or hybrid work. Access to state-of-the-art prototyping labs, company-sponsored hackathons, and innovation grants can further enhance job satisfaction. For senior roles, consider offering performance bonuses, stock options, or profit-sharing plans. A positive company culture that values creativity, collaboration, and continuous learning is often a deciding factor for top candidates.

Provide Onboarding and Continuous Development

A well-structured onboarding process is essential for integrating a new Drone Design employee into your organization and setting them up for long-term success. Begin by providing a comprehensive orientation that covers company policies, team structure, and an overview of ongoing drone projects. Assign a mentor or buddy”preferably a senior team member”who can guide the new hire through their first weeks, answer questions, and facilitate introductions to key stakeholders.

Ensure that all necessary tools, software licenses, and equipment are ready before the employee's start date. Provide access to documentation, design standards, and previous project files to help them understand your organization's design philosophy and technical requirements. Schedule regular check-ins during the first 90 days to review progress, address challenges, and gather feedback.

Encourage participation in team meetings, design reviews, and cross-functional workshops to foster collaboration and knowledge sharing. Offer training sessions on proprietary tools or processes unique to your company. Set clear performance expectations and milestones, and provide constructive feedback to help the new hire grow in their role.

A thoughtful onboarding experience not only accelerates productivity but also increases employee engagement and retention. By investing in your new Drone Design employee's success from day one, you lay the groundwork for innovative solutions and a strong, cohesive team.
